How much do remote property guardian j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ote property guardian in the United States is $21.95,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.55 and $25.72 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Property Guardian vs Property Manager?

AspectRemote Property GuardianProperty Manager
CredentialsNo formal certifications typically requiredReal estate or property management cert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entRemote or on-site, mainly guarding vacant propertiesOffice-based and on-site property oversight
Employer & IndustrySecurity companies, property guardianship firmsReal estate agencies, property management firms
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ding guarding roles, remote work optionsProperty oversight, leasing, and maintenance

The main difference is that Remote Property Guardians primarily focus on securing vacant properties remotely or on-site without traditional management duties, while Property Managers oversee the day-to-day operations, leasing, and maintenance of properties. Guardianship roles are often more flexible and less formal, whereas property management involves more responsibilities and certifications.

What is a remote property guardian?

A Remote Property Guardian is a professional responsible for monitoring and safeguarding properties from a distance, using technology such as security systems, surveillance cameras, and smart home devices. They ensure the property remains secure, report any issues or suspicious activities, and may coordinate with local services if needed. This role is especially important for vacant homes, vacation rentals, or commercial properties where the owner is not on-site. The guardian may also handle routine check-ins or oversee maintenance remotely.
